Transaction 2ec23daf6bc92df8695df06806033ce860c3e3d690a36a553c949b1ef4a075c5
1 Input
1 Output
-
2ec23daf6bc92df8695df06806033ce860c3e3d690a36a553c949b1ef4a075c5:0
- value
- 1077000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c79b2b851258fad73d7601d2b52209144b85c4a OP_EQUAL
- address
- 3FxP8Ck28a8PNV3eYqsJWK2L4gFncEo7Yr